A small toy project to try out different features of Enzyme.
Functions (with autodiff
macro) imported from modules are not working properly.
See main.rs
# num-dual for comparison
[src/main.rs:33:5] dual_y1 = Dual {
re: 4.497780053946162,
eps: 4.05342789389862,
f: PhantomData<f64>,
}
# identical function as below, but defined in lib.rs
[src/main.rs:34:5] enzyme_y1_lib = (
4.497780053946161,
0.0, # <--- ?
)
# identical function as above, but defined in main.rs
[src/main.rs:35:5] enzyme_y1f = (
4.497780053946161,
4.05342789389862,
)

A quick check against num-dual
for the forward-mode first derivative. These cases should be directly comparable. Probably not trustworthy because execution times are very short.
To run benchmark:
cargo bench
Criterion output:
Enzyme: 1st order/forward time: [507.19 ps 507.52 ps 507.85 ps]
num-dual: 1st order/Dual64 time: [311.51 ps 311.77 ps 312.03 ps]
